Caring for a healthy lawn during the year demands a active strategy responsive to the specific needs of each time of year. In spring, concentrate on cleaning up debris and aerating the soil, which aids to encourage strong root growth. Feeding in early spring can also give your lawn the fertilizers it requires to thrive. It's the ideal time to seed or overseed any barren patches, guaranteeing a lush green sod as the temperatures gets milder.
As the summer approaches, keeping your lawn vibrant and thriving becomes a priority, particularly in hotter climates. Irrigate deeply and sparingly to promote strong root growth, and contemplate using mulch to retain moisture and protect your soil from heat. Regular mowing is crucial during this time, but be careful not to cut the grass too short, as this can harm the grass and lead to a faded, splotchy look.
When fall approaches, it's important to prepare your lawn for the cooler months. This necessitates continuing to mow and rake leaves to prevent smothering the grass. Incorporating sustainable gardening practices into your garden layout not only enhances aesthetics but also supports ecological health. Employing native plants is a key strategy; such species are naturally adapted to your area's climate and soil, demanding less water and maintenance. Additionally, native plants provide critical habitats for local wildlife, including pollinators such as bees and butterflies, which are important for a balanced ecosystem. In choosing plants, consider their drought resistance and seasonal benefits to guarantee they flourish throughout the year.
A further important aspect of sustainable landscaping is reducing water usage. Adopting xeriscaping techniques allows you to create an attractive landscape with low-water needs. Techniques may consist of grouping plants with similar watering needs, using mulch to retain moisture, and installing drip irrigation systems that effectively deliver water straight to the plant roots. These methods not only help sustain a lush landscape but also significantly lower water consumption, rendering your garden more eco-friendly.
